In columns and editorials opinion is expected. Writers take varying approaches but the idea is to make the writing lively and the subject interesting. The concept of an editorial campaign such as the one on climate change that The Guardian launched is nearly as old as the idea of establishing an editorial page and separating out opinion from news.
